Question:

A portable CD player uses a current of 7.5 mA at a potential difference of 3.5 V.
(a) How much energy does the player use in 35 s?
(b) Suppose the player has a mass of 0.65 kg. For what length of time could the player operate on the energy required to lift it through a height of 1.0 m?
